MRNA Looks 476.4% Overvalued on GF Value™

Moderna Inc (MRNA) shares rose 0.71% to $138.97 on August 31, 2026, with bullish options activity. The company's P/S ratio is 24.69, above its historical median of 8.4, indicating high growth expectations. GuruFocus' GF Value™ suggests MRNA is 476.4% overvalued. Insider activity shows $47.8M in selling over 12 months, while guru holdings are mixed.

FDA Approves New Covid Shots From Pfizer and Moderna

FDA approved updated Covid vaccines from Pfizer (Comirnaty XFG) and Moderna (Spikevax, mNEXSPIKE) targeting the XFG variant for the 2026-2027 season. Approvals were based on mouse studies and prior human data, with human trials for the new formulations not yet started. The shots are approved for specific age groups and high-risk individuals. Both companies expect rapid availability. The approvals follow substantial government contracts and include warnings for myocarditis and pericarditis.

Merck and Moderna's cancer vaccine is customized for each patient

Merck & Co. and Moderna developed a personalized cancer vaccine, customized for each patient's tumor genome, to be used with Merck's Keytruda. The FDA granted Breakthrough Therapy designation in 2023. Phase 3 trials showed a 44% reduction in recurrence risk for melanoma patients. The companies are also exploring its use in lung, renal cell, and bladder cancers.
